MARK GLADYSZ
A registered professional planner, Mark Gladysz RPP, OPPI has over 30 years of experience in city planning in a variety of municipalities across Ontario. Mark has extensive experience in the areas of land development, policy writing, intensification, urban design, infrastructure planning, historic building preservation, animation of public space, financial incentives and project management of special studies and construction projects. Currently, Mark is the principal consultant of Heritagedowntowns.com , which is a planning consultancy specializing downtown revitalization, providing strategies for the rejuvenation and intensification of older commercial and mixed-use residential areas.Currently Mark is working on intensification projects in Toronto, Kitchener, Kingston and Brantford.

ROBIN ETHERINGTON
Cultural Consultant
Robin Etherington has worked for many national and community level cultural organizations over the past 30 years. Her area of consultant specialty at Etherington Consulting Services is management of not-for profit and cultural organizations and has improved the bottom line at many sites through tighter operations, expansive partnerships and maximizing networking opportunities. She has developed tremendous skills in grant writing, social media, youth outreach, marketing, policy writing and implementation, and community facilitation. Skills include developing and implementing fund development (fundraising and revenue generation) strategies; Cultural Resources Management (CRM), and cultural strategic planning.
